The Type 3610J or 3610JP pneumatic positioners and the Type 3620J or 3620JP electro-pneumatic positioners are used with diaphragm rotary actuators and with piston rotary actuators as shown in figure 1.The Type 3611JP and 3621JP positioners are used with the Type 585, 585R, 585C, or 585CR sliding stem actuators as shown in figure 2.

Introduction
The positioner mounts integrally to the actuator housing and provides a valve ball, disk, or plug position for a specific input signal. The positioner accepts either a pneumatic or milliampere input signal. Refer to the type number description for a detailed explanation of type numbers.

Type Number Description

The following descriptions provide specific information on the different positioner constructions. If the type number is not known, refer to the nameplate on the positioner. For the nameplate location, refer to key 157, figure 25.

Type 3610J: A single-acting pneumatic rotary valve positioner for use with Type 1051 and 1052 actuators. Type 3610JP: A double-acting pneumatic rotary valve positioner for use with Type 1061 and 1069 actuators. Type 3611JP: A double-acting pneumatic sliding stem valve positioner for use with Type 585, 585R, 585C, and 585CR actuators.
